Food recall warnings by the Canadian Food Inspection Agency occurs almost every week in Canada.

Here's an expert who can answers questions about food safety:

Jennifer Ronholm, Department of Food Science and Agricultural Chemistry, McGill University

Professor Ronhom's research area involved the study of bacterial surface proteins which would allow the identification of particularly virulent strains of Listeria monocytogenes and Salmonella. She worked previously with Health Canada where she focused on developing genomics based techniques for evaluating and improving the safety of several food products, particularly seafood. She can discuss Listeria, Salmonella, and norovirus contamination, among other things.
